Key components you should expect from an advanced SMS aggregator
A reliable inbound SMS solution is composed of several layered capabilities that work in concert. Below are the components that distinguish production-grade platforms from hobbyist setups:
- Inbound routing and short code support:The system must support inbound messages from short codes such as 68382 short code and route them to your application via secure APIs or webhooks. The routing should be deterministic, with low latency, and offer retry logic in case of transient network issues.
- Two-way messaging and auto-fetch:Inbound messages should be processed automatically, with responses and acknowledgments delivered through reliable channels. Auto-fetch implies that the platform polls or receives websocket/webhook callbacks to capture new messages in real time.
- Message parsing and deduplication:Incoming content must be parsed according to campaign rules, with deduplication to prevent repeated actions from the same user and idempotent processing guarantees.
- API and webhook ecosystem:A mature API layer with REST or HTTP endpoints, plus webhook callbacks to your CRM, marketing automation, or fraud-detection systems. Rate limits, security tokens, and granular permissions help protect your data flows.
- Compliance and opt-in management:The platform enforces consent capture, retention policies, and opt-out handling to align with regional rules and industry standards.
- Analytics and monitoring:Real-time dashboards, message-level analytics, and uptime metrics let you measure delivery, latency, and throughput while enabling proactive issue resolution.

Tips for maximizing automatic SMS reception
- Define clear inbound intents:Map message types (verification, opt-in, support inquiries) to dedicated processing flows so that each inbound message triggers the correct action in your system.
- Use idempotent handlers:Design webhook endpoints and message handlers that can safely process repeated deliveries without side effects.
- Implement robust opt-in/opt-out controls:Maintain auditable consent trails and comply with regional regulations to avoid penalties and reputational risk.
- Prioritize latency-sensitive paths:Route inbound messages through the fastest available gateway, with automatic retry logic for failed deliveries.
- Leverage webhooks for near real-time responses:Use callbacks to keep downstream systems synchronized, enabling instant user interactions and timely alerts.
- Monitor performance continuously:Establish dashboards for inbound latency, success rate, and incident response times to catch issues before users do.
- Test across regions:Validate inbound flows in Vietnam and other target markets to ensure consistent behavior under load and regulator expectations.
Cautions and potential pitfalls: what to watch out for
- Overloading downstream systems:If your CRM or marketing automation cannot absorb inbound events at peak load, implement backpressure controls and queueing to prevent data loss.
- Inadequate validation of inbound content:Validate message formats to avoid injecting malformed data into your workflows, which can cause exceptions and security risks.
- Non-compliance with regional rules:Inbound messaging may be subject to local consent and data retention rules. Build policies that reflect regional expectations, and audit them regularly.
- Vendor lock-in risks:Choose a platform with open APIs, standard webhooks, and predictable data schemas to preserve portability if you decide to switch providers.
- Security considerations for inbound channels:Protect webhook endpoints with tokens, IP allowlists, and request signing. Inbound data can reveal personal information; enforce encryption at rest and in transit.
Technical deep dive: how the service works under the hood
The architecture behind automatic SMS reception is designed for reliability, scalability, and ease of integration. Here is a practical walkthrough of the typical workflow you would implement with an enterprise-grade SMS aggregator:
- Inbound message capture:When a user sends an SMS to a short code (for example, 68382 short code), the carrier network forwards the message to the aggregator’s inbound gateway. The gateway is connected to multiple carriers to provide high availability and fast failover.
- Normalization and validation:The message is normalized into a consistent schema, validated for content, and enriched with metadata such as timestamp, signaling, and routing path.
- Routing decision:The inbound engine applies routing rules based on the campaign, customer, or user context. It decides which webhook or API endpoint should receive the event and whether retries are necessary.
- Delivery to your systems:The inbound event is delivered to your application via HTTP webhook or a polling API. You can configure retry policies, backoff strategies, and authentication tokens to secure the flow.
- Two-way messaging and responses:If your flow requires a reply (for example, OTP or confirmation), the platform can initiate outbound messages based on the inbound content, respecting opt-in status and rate limits.
- Monitoring and analytics:Every inbound message is logged with diagnostic data. You can monitor success rates, latency, and downstream processing times to optimize performance.
From a technical standpoint, you should also consider:
- API stability:Rely on stable versioned APIs with clear deprecation timelines to minimize integration risk.
- Security controls:Use OAuth or token-based authentication for webhook endpoints, rotate secrets regularly, and enable IP filtering.
- Scaling strategy:Plan for peak inbound volumes with auto-scaling compute resources and queueing to absorb bursts without dropping messages.
- Data residency and privacy:Ensure data processing complies with local laws (for example, data localization in certain regions) and industry standards (ISO 27001, SOC 2, GDPR where applicable).

Implementation tips: what to prepare before you start
- Define your inbound data contract:Decide the fields you expect, how you’ll handle optional data, and how to normalize messages for downstream systems.
- Prepare your API endpoints:Expose secure, versioned endpoints for inbound events, with clear success/failure semantics and idempotent processing guarantees.
- Plan opt-in storytelling:Build a consent-first experience, with explicit opt-ins and easy opt-out options enforced across all campaigns.
- Set up monitoring and alerts:Instrument inbound latency, delivery success, and error budgets to catch problems early and respond fast.
- Test comprehensively in target markets:Validate inbound behavior in Vietnam and other regions before scaling campaigns to production loads.
